Evanston’s basketball team was awarded the No. 1 seed for the Class 4A Glenbrook South Sectional grouping according to pairings released by the Illinois High School Association this week.
Coach Mike Ellis’ team was voted No. 1 by participating coaches ahead of No. 2 Deerfield, No. 3 Stevenson and No. 4 Notre Dame in the 21-team field. The Wildkits will open play in the Warren Regional on Tuesday, March 1 at 7 p.m. against the Warren-Glenbrook South winner.
Also participating in the Warren Regional are No. 8 Niles North and No. 9 Libertyville. The championship game is set for March 4 at 7 p.m.
The Wildkits saw their 13-game winning string snapped Friday night in Park Ridge in a 61-55 loss to Maine South. Evanston fell to 21-3 overall with two games left in the regular season, a matchup with Chicago Simeon on Saturday and a Central Suburban League crossover date at Deerfield next Wednesday.
Nojel Eastern scored a career-high 28 points and added 9 rebounds and 7 assists versus Maine South as the division champion Wildkits settled for a final league record of 9-1.
